Oklahoma HB1939 amends the Oklahoma Turnpike Authority's powers and duties, focusing on the expiration of legislative authorization for certain turnpike projects. The bill specifies that authorization for projects authorized before November 1, 2025, expires unless construction has started within five years of that date. Projects authorized on or after November 1, 2025, also face expiration unless construction begins within five years. The Authority retains the ability to reauthorize expired projects.
